Subject: | Designating the 2023 "School Bus Safety Week" in Pennsylvania |
In the near future, we intend to introduce a resolution designating the week of October 16-20, 2023, as “School Bus Safety Week” in Pennsylvania in accordance with National School Bus Safety Week as announced by both the National Association for Pupil Transportation and Pennsylvania’s Department of Transportation (PennDOT). According to the Pennsylvania School Bus Association (PSBA), each year approximately 450,000 school buses travel an estimated 4.3 billion miles transporting roughly 23.5 million students to and from school and school-related activities. In communities across our Commonwealth, school bus drivers transport our children with an incredible safety record and a fatality rate at a fraction of the rate experienced by general motorists. PennDOT provides information for drivers, parents and student-passengers as a general reminder to increase safety. This includes obeying general traffic laws like the observance of school zone safety protocols while driving and coming to a full stop when driving behind a bus, meeting the bus or approaching an intersection where a bus is stopped. Motorists following or traveling alongside a school bus must also stop until the red lights have stopped flashing, the stop arm is withdrawn and all children have exited the road and reached safety. Our resolution intends to highlight these safety precautions and bring awareness to all the work school bus drivers do to guarantee our most precious resource, our children, arrive at their destinations on time, safely. Raising awareness of the importance of safety for our school bus drivers, student-passengers and motorists sharing the roads with our buses is critically important to children, families and communities back home in our districts.
